Handle detectors with bias voltages up to 5000V DC, ensure proper grounding, and use caution with high voltage circuits.
Ensure main amplifier settings for coarse gain are 100 and fine gain is 10.
Increase high voltage in 100V steps, measure the test point voltage, and observe/record noise on the scope.
Stop bias application when noise shakes or the test point (TP) voltage goes to high values (-10V or more).
Use specific gain, pileup, P/Z, BLR, and peaking time settings for non-DSG main amplifiers.
